LA based punk rockers Death Lens have released their crushing new single and video, Daemon, which will appear on their highly anticipated upcoming album No Luck, that is set for release on April 15th via Secret Friends Music Group. The official music video adds a compelling and clever visual narrative to the track, the bands music will also be featured on an episode of MTV’s Ridiculousness. The band will perform at the Treefort Festival in Boise, ID on March 26th and 27th, they will also be supporting Together Pangea for a five day run starting March 28th.
Daemon is Death Lens doing what they do best, pummeling audiences with fuzzed out SoCal style punk that encapsulates a hardcore attitude, skate culture and social awareness. The latest single hits hard with caustic riffs and catchy melodies that are as easy to mosh to as they are to sing along with. While the song blazes along at a breakneck pace, the precise playing from the band prevents it from going off the rails. The group emphasizes a well curated personal style as well as their working class, multi-cultural roots and showcase this with lyrics that speak to the hardships of life with an undercurrent of positivity and resilience.
“The video shows what goes on in our heads as we casually practice ‘DAEMON’. The people watching don’t exist, they are figments of our imaginations. They each represent a life struggle, along with world struggles, that we have to manage and deal with everyday. The last man standing at the end, raising his fist up high, is the little voice that is working overtime to keep us all optimistic even in the darkest of times.” (Singer Bryan Torres)
